INSURANCE REQUIREMENTS:

It is a requirement of the contracts to be procured under the proposed framework agreement that tenderers hold, or can commit to obtain

prior to the commencement of any subsequently awarded contract, the types and levels of insurance indicated below:

Employer’s (Compulsory) Liability Insurance – maintain a minimum indemnity limit of GBP 10 million in respect of each claim, and without limit to the number of claims.

Public Liability Insurance – maintain a minimum indemnity limit of GBP 10 million in respect of each claim, and without limit to the number of claims.

Product Liability Insurance – maintain a minimum indemnity limit of GBP 10 million in the aggregate.

Motor Vehicle Insurance – maintain a minimum indemnity limit of GBP 5 million for Property Damage, and unlimited in respect of Third-Party Injury.

OTHER ECONOMIC AND FINANCIAL REQUIREMENTS:

A search of the tenderer against Equifax's Protect must not return a 'Warning' or 'Caution' returnable code or any neutral code, unless the tenderer confirms that it can provide any other document which Scotland Excel considers appropriate to prove to Scotland Excel (acting within its permitted discretion under the applicable public procurement rules) that the tenderer does/would not present an unmanageable risk should it be appointed on to the proposed Framework Agreement. Equifax's protect is a fraud indicator/credit risk search and analysis of five areas of threat in relation to a particular company: credit history; disqualification; validation and investigation bureau; connected data; and bureau information.
